SUMMARY

The Program Management Specialist at USAID/Belarus plays a pivotal role in the strategic planning, implementation, and oversight of key programmatic initiatives aimed at advancing Belarus towards a functional, market-based democracy. Collaborates closely and supports the USAID/Belarus Country Representative, contributing to the development, evaluation, and refinement of comprehensive program strategies. Engages in high-level analysis, policy formulation, and ensuring the effective use of resources to achieve targeted outcomes, their work is instrumental in navigating Belarus's complex, sensitive, and rapidly evolving geopolitical landscape.

KEY D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
Essential Duties and responsibilities include the following. Other duties may be assigned.

Strategic Influence and Program Design (35%)

Leads in formulating and continuously refining the program strategy, ensuring alignment with USG priorities and responsiveness to Belarus's dynamic needs.

Acts as a principal contributor in defining program objectives and results, employing innovative approaches to overcome design and policy challenges.

Drives the integration of sector-specific projects into the overarching country program strategy, leveraging technical expertise and fostering cross-functional collaboration.

Spearheads the development of comprehensive program assessments to identify strategic impact opportunities and adjust program focus based on performance metrics analysis.

Advanced Budget Planning and Fiscal Oversight (15%)

Architects and manages a sophisticated program budgeting process, employing advanced analytical techniques to forecast funding needs and optimize resource allocation.

Influences budgetary priorities and ensure alignment with programmatic objectives, leading strategic planning of financial resources.

Represents the program's financial interests in high-level discussions, advocating for necessary resources to achieve mission goals.

Elevated Program Monitoring, Evaluation, and Learning (20%)

Champions a robust performance management system, setting evaluation and learning standards to drive program excellence.

Orchestrates monitoring and evaluation activities, using data to inform strategic decision-making and promote adaptive management.

Cultivates a learning culture within the program team, facilitating the integration of best practices into program design and implementation.

Strategic Communications and Program Advocacy (20%)

Leads the program's communications strategy, enhancing visibility and articulating the value and impact of USAID's work in Belarus.

Advises on strategic communications, ensuring program achievements and lessons learned are effectively disseminated and utilized.

Program Review Management and Implementation (10%)

Leads strategic planning for annual Operational Plans (OP) and Performance Plans and Reports (PPR), reflecting mission priorities accurately.

Spearheads comprehensive Performance Reports development, articulating outcomes and impacts based on programmatic data.

Serves as a liaison for cross-functional coordination, integrating diverse perspectives into cohesive program strategies.

Leads programmatic strategy evaluations, recommending adjustments based on findings to align with changing priorities.

Provides expert guidance on USAID and USG foreign assistance processes, enhancing mission staff and partner capacities.

Manages key operational systems, ensuring accurate and timely data entry to support decision-making and reporting.
